Which statement best describes the graph of -x3 - x2 + 4x + 4? It starts down on the left and goes up on the right and intersects the axis at x = -2, 2, and 4. It starts down on the left and goes up on the right and intersects the axis at x = -2, -1, and 2. It starts up on the left and goes down on the right and intersects the x-axis at x = -2, -1, and 2. It starts up on the left and goes down on the right and intersects the axis at x = -2, 2, and 4.
The leading coefficient -1 (of \(x^3\) is negative, hence the curve starts up on the left (but starts down if the leading coefficient is positive). This eliminates A and B. Between C and D, the only difference in roots is -1 or 4. Check whether x=-1 or 4 will result in a zero to the given expression and you have your choice.
